Weak acids and bases are less … WebJun 24, 2024 · Explanation: A strong base is a base that ionises or dissociates almost 100% in water to form OH − ion. An example of a strong base is sodium hydroxide. It dissociates in water to form sodium ion and hydroxide ion. WebWeak acids and the acid dissociation constant, K_\text {a} K a. Weak acids are acids that don't completely dissociate in solution. In other words, a weak acid is any acid that is not a strong acid. The strength of a weak acid depends on how much it dissociates: the more it dissociates, the stronger the acid. Web23.2 Acid and Base Ionization Constants. The relative strength of an acid or base is the extent to which it ionizes when dissolved in water. If the ionization reaction is essentially complete, the acid or base is termed strong; if relatively little ionization occurs, the acid or base is weak.As will be evident throughout the remainder of this chapter, there are many …
